The Jerome Classic is Canada’s stage for track and field. The home of where racing legends find flight, this annual event has hosted Olympic athletes such as Damien Warner, Andre de Grasse, Melissa Bishop, Evan Dunfee and others. Inspired by Olympian Harry Jerome, the Jerome Classic is where speed reigns and strength launches athletes into motion.

Events

The Jerome Classic is Canada’s best track and field event, first held in 1964, titled as the ‘The International Olympic Preview’, and held annually since 1984. As a true track and field Classic, events include track sprints, hurdles, middle distances, jumps and throws. In addition, the event hosts a Special Olympics 100m and Youth Relays.

2024 was also an epic year at the Jerome Classic with four Meet records set by stars Kieran Lumb, 1500m in 3:34.53, Thomas Fafard, 3000m in 7:41.20, Gabriela DeBues-Stafford, 5000m in 15:17.48, plus Rajindra Campbell with a 21.54m shot put. View the 2024 Results.

2025 saw a combined eight Meet and National Records set at the Jerome Classic. Max Davies runs 3:35.04 in the 1500m event to break the previous U23 record set back in 1992. De’vion Wilson in 13.44 surpasses Canadian legend Mark McCoy‘s previous Meet Record from 1986 (13.45) by 0.01 seconds in the 110m. Evan Dunfee broke his own previous record by over five seconds with a time of 11:02.07. Olivia Lundman hits a national record in the U23 category in 12:56.26, and Maya Piesik breaks Lundman’s U18 record (14:25.74) with a time of 14:21.83. 

Sarah Mitton showcases her strength by smashing the previous meet record, her own in 19.83, with a new mark of 20.14m. Charlotte Bolton maintains Canadian records in the F41 (Para) throwing events, breaking her own shot put record (9.05) with a throw of 9.62m. Julia Hanes also breaks her own Canadian record with a new mark of 7.52m in the F33 (Para Wheelchair) category. View the 2025 Highlights

Tuesday, July 14, 2026, at Swangard Stadium, Burnaby

Also part of Athletics Canada’s National Track and Field Tour, the Jerome Classic is on the World Athletics Continental Tour.
